草庐IT

php dns 记录

全部标签

mysql - 选择列在多个记录中包含相同数据的行

有很多标题相似的问题,但我一直没能找到不涉及groupby(GROUPBYxHAVINGCOUNT(*)>1)的答案,但我正在寻找的是是一个返回所有未分组行的查询(在MySQL中)。假设我有以下内容:iddata1x2y3y4z我希望查询返回的是:2y3y基于第2行和第3行在数据列中具有相同值的事实。SELECT*FROMtableWHERE[数据包含的值也存在于其他行] 最佳答案 你必须把它放在一个子查询中select*fromtablewheredatain(selectdatafromtablegroupbydatahavin

java - Play & Ebean - 获得第一条记录

如何使用play.db.ebean.Model.Finder获取数据库中表的第一条记录,就像“first”方法一样。相应的SQL是:SELECT*FROMmy_tableLIMIT1; 最佳答案 让我们假设模型Student@EntitypublicclassStudent{@Idpublicintid;publicStringname;}模型查找器将是publicstaticFinderfind=newFinder(Long.class,Student.class);以1为单位检索学生限制publicstaticStudentge

php - 如何从表 mysql 中获取前 5 条和最后 1 条记录?

我正在做一个php小项目,这里我需要从记录开始的前5条记录和从表记录末尾开始的最后一条记录1。我不知道如何编写单个mysqli查询。任何帮助将不胜感激。提前致谢。 最佳答案 SQL表表示无序集。因此,没有前五行或最后一行之类的东西——除非列明确定义了顺序。通常,一个表有某种自动递增的id列,可用于此目的。如果是这样,您可以这样做:(selectt.*fromtorderbyidasclimit5)unionall(selectt.*fromtorderbyiddesclimit1);注意事项:有时,插入日期/时间列是适合使用的列。您

php - 统计返回的记录 MySQL Doctrine

如何检查从我的MySQL数据库中搜索返回的记录数像这样的声明:$searchKey='Somethingtosearchfor';$searchResults=Doctrine::getTable('TableName')->createQuery('t')->where('columnNameLIKE?','%'.$searchKey.'%')->execute(); 最佳答案 也许$searchResults->rowCount();来自here 关于php-统计返回的记录MySQL

如果记录在其他表中不存在,则 MySQL 更新

我想弄清楚是否可以检查表B中是否存在特定记录。如果存在,请不要更新表A。我试过谷歌搜索,但我只找到了插入版本,我不确定更新查询是否可行。提前致谢 最佳答案 updatetable_to_updatesetsome_column=123whereid=1andidnotin(selectidfromtable_b) 关于如果记录在其他表中不存在,则MySQL更新,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.

mysql - 如何使用sql计算一小时(日期时间)内的记录数

这个问题在这里已经有了答案:关闭10年前。PossibleDuplicate:Grouprecordsbytime我有一个记录网页请求的mysql表。我想写一个sql来输出每小时的请求数。INPUT:timestampbrowser--------------------------2012-06-2815:06:14chrome2012-06-2815:12:15IE62012-06-2816:32:16IE7OUTPUT:timestampcount--------------------------2012-06-2815:00:0022012-06-2816:00:001我猜我

mysql - 如何针对 LIKE '%abc%' 查询优化包含 1.6+ 万条记录的 MySQL 表

我有一个具有这种结构的表,它目前包含大约160万条记录。CREATETABLE`chatindex`(`timestamp`timestampNOTNULLDEFAULTCURRENT_TIMESTAMP,`roomname`varchar(90)COLLATEutf8_binNOTNULL,`username`varchar(60)COLLATEutf8_binNOTNULL,`filecount`int(10)unsignedNOTNULL,`connection`int(2)unsignedNOTNULL,`primaryip`int(10)unsignedNOTNULL,`pr

MySQL只计算新记录

如何编写MySQL查询来完成此任务?表:作者w_idw_name---------------1Michael2Samantha3John---------------表:文章a_idw_idtimestampa_name----------------------------------------111PHPprogramming233Otherprogramminglanguages335Anotherarticle4215Webdesign5120MySQL----------------------------------------只需要COUNT作者发表第一篇文章的时间不

jquery - 是否可以使用 jquery 和 mysql 在数据库表中插入一条新记录?

我参加了一份工作的面试,他们问了我一个问题,比如如何仅使用jquery和mysql将新记录插入数据库?我回答要用jqueryajax,但是他们不接受,他们说我们只想用jquery和mysql而不用其他的。我在谷歌搜索并没有得到可能的解决方案。你能帮助我吗? 最佳答案 JavaScript/jQuery不能直接连接到数据库,这有很多好处您需要对服务器进行Ajax调用,以将要放入数据库的数据发送出去。支持的服务器端代码将连接到mysql服务器。 关于jquery-是否可以使用jquery和m

java - ListArray 保存相同的记录

我正在尝试将我的数据库表保存在Students类的ListArray中。publicListgetData(){//_Students.clear();StudentstempStudent=newStudents();Liststudents=newArrayList();dbConnect();try{stmt=c.createStatement();rs=stmt.executeQuery("SELECT*FROMStudents;");intsize=0;while(rs.next()){tempStudent.studentId=rs.getInt("StudentNo");